The Ballot Machine

A program that asks for candidates, and launches a voting window. Every time a vote is cast, a short tune will play so you can tell if someone is voting more than once. When the administrator desires to end the election and see the results, he can click on the results button and view a table of candidates and the votes they received.

Nothing too fancy, but it probably works just as well as the Diebold machines. This was my first project done in Netbeans/any IDE, and I love it. No messing around with painful-to-use Java layouts, just drag and drop! All of my previous programs were done in Notepad++.
